| CVE-2019-5029 | 1 Exhibitor Project | 1 Exhibitor | 2022-06-07 | 10.0 HIGH | 9.8 CRITICAL |
| An exploitable command injection vulnerability exists in the Config editor of the Exhibitor Web UI versions 1.0.9 to 1.7.1. Arbitrary shell commands surrounded by backticks or $() can be inserted into the editor and will be executed by the Exhibitor process when it launches ZooKeeper. An attacker can execute any command as the user running the Exhibitor process. | |||||
| CVE-2019-5030 | 1 Antennahouse | 1 Rainbow Pdf Office Server Document Converter | 2022-06-07 | 6.8 MEDIUM | 8.8 HIGH |
| A buffer overflow vulnerability exists in the PowerPoint document conversion function of Rainbow PDF Office Server Document Converter V7.0 Pro MR1 (7,0,2019,0220). While parsing a document text info container, the TxMasterStyleAtom::parse function is incorrectly checking the bounds corresponding to the number of style levels, causing a vtable pointer to be overwritten, which leads to code execution. | |||||
| CVE-2019-5023 | 1 Opensrcsec | 2 Grsecurity, Pax | 2022-06-07 | 4.3 MEDIUM | 5.9 MEDIUM |
| An exploitable vulnerability exists in the grsecurity PaX patch for the function read_kmem, in PaX from version pax-linux-4.9.8-test1 to 4.9.24-test7, grsecurity official from version grsecurity-3.1-4.9.8-201702060653 to grsecurity-3.1-4.9.24-201704252333, grsecurity unofficial from version v4.9.25-unofficialgrsec to v4.9.74-unofficialgrsec. PaX adds a temp buffer to the read_kmem function, which is never freed when an invalid address is supplied. This results in a memory leakage that can lead to a crash of the system. An attacker needs to induce a read to /dev/kmem using an invalid address to exploit this vulnerability. | |||||

| CVE-2020-13580 | 1 Softmaker | 1 Planmaker 2021 | 2022-06-07 | 6.8 MEDIUM | 7.8 HIGH |
| An exploitable heap-based buffer overflow vulnerability exists in the PlanMaker document parsing functionality of SoftMaker Office 2021’s PlanMaker application. A specially crafted document can cause the document parser to explicitly trust a length from a particular record type and use it to write a 16-bit null relative to a buffer allocated on the stack. Due to a lack of bounds-checking on this value, this can allow an attacker to write to memory outside of the buffer and controllably corrupt memory. This can allow an attacker to earn code execution under the context of the application. An attacker can entice the victim to open a document to trigger this vulnerability. | |||||

| CVE-2022-29248 | 2 Drupal, Guzzlephp | 2 Drupal, Guzzle | 2022-06-07 | 5.8 MEDIUM | 8.1 HIGH |
| Guzzle is a PHP HTTP client. Guzzle prior to versions 6.5.6 and 7.4.3 contains a vulnerability with the cookie middleware. The vulnerability is that it is not checked if the cookie domain equals the domain of the server which sets the cookie via the Set-Cookie header, allowing a malicious server to set cookies for unrelated domains. The cookie middleware is disabled by default, so most library consumers will not be affected by this issue. Only those who manually add the cookie middleware to the handler stack or construct the client with ['cookies' => true] are affected. Moreover, those who do not use the same Guzzle client to call multiple domains and have disabled redirect forwarding are not affected by this vulnerability. Guzzle versions 6.5.6 and 7.4.3 contain a patch for this issue. As a workaround, turn off the cookie middleware. | |||||
| CVE-2022-1664 | 1 Debian | 2 Debian Linux, Dpkg | 2022-06-07 | 7.5 HIGH | 9.8 CRITICAL |
| Dpkg::Source::Archive in dpkg, the Debian package management system, before version 1.21.8, 1.20.10, 1.19.8, 1.18.26 is prone to a directory traversal vulnerability. When extracting untrusted source packages in v2 and v3 source package formats that include a debian.tar, the in-place extraction can lead to directory traversal situations on specially crafted orig.tar and debian.tar tarballs. | |||||
